Output 7da27685169943c106541ebc370e20c4fe936be5ee793eb0ee4bb03b9f88d1d1:23

value
756417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17752c80b03794bfcac98f705d9129f9706314a4 OP_EQUAL
address
33q3qLVYp9cCgGTEDgTXgK8FhAJbekzZai
transaction
7da27685169943c106541ebc370e20c4fe936be5ee793eb0ee4bb03b9f88d1d1
spent
true